While I doubt Nintendo would make XY/XX/XZ/YZ/X2/Y2/Just Z™ exclusive there are two other examples that might set a precedent.
The big one is Crystal, which unlike Gold and Silver was exclusive to Gameboy Colour. The new 3DS seems to function almost exactly like the GBC did, so it's possible the allure of that better CPU might be enough. However, I think it's more likely they'll go down the route of my second example of Black/White. Those games had a few DSi exclusive features, like being able to video chat at 5fps and using WPA2 wifi signals instead of the DS' standard WEP.
